About

36425990_TB3y2Gr7ErnAu0B.jpg

Vanai is a minor goddess who has travelled the stars alongside a small but dedicated group of Falidari after their original homeworld was destroyed in a great catastrophe. They were dragged into a larger fleet of more hostile ships, but were able to disengage and defect when it encountered an inhabited planet. Vanai's people have remained in orbit since, settling down on one of Senti's moons, and Vanai has quite happily gotten to know the local deity.

Personality

Vanai is calm and level-headed, good at reining in her emotions in the face of adversity. She's just beginning to relax after spending a few short but dangerous millennia shepherding her followers through a dangerous period of living and working alongside the Orsinx. Her patience ultimately paid off, allowing her to guide her Falidari away from the Orsinx just as they were losing their war with the peoples of Senti, which finally freed both them and herself from following the tyrannical Ora.

She has grown quite close to Aisenn, the goddess local to Senti, since her defection. Senn's playful nature has brought a lot of joy to her life, and with her people safe to settle again, she isn't as afraid to spend time away from closely watching them.

History

40296510_rdJxAZlM2eRw5DY.png

Vanai is a younger deity, having coaelesced in the Higher Planes only six rotations ago. The petty infighting in the realm above exhausted her, even at a young age, so she descended into the physical planes to search for a calmer place to exist in peace.

She soon settled within the Aiouran universe, on a planet that orbited a binary star system. Here she played with manipulating the environment and pushing life to evolve once she'd established optimal conditions, a process that, over a few eons, gave rise to the Falinari, a sapient species of horned, feline being. Vanai followed their development with delight, nudging them in the right direction whenever they got off track, and soon they were exploring the space around the planet and making their first interplanetary trips.

Their relative peace was disrupted when the Orsinx fleet arrived in their system. The Orsinx were a humanoid race micromanaged by an acrid deity known as Ora, and they had a habit of plundering any planet with available resources to fuel their eternal march to feed Ora the magic found at the hearts of worlds inhabited by deities. Fearing both her peoples' destruction and her own, Vanai made a deal with Ora, offering the planet if her people could only build a fleet and preserve their world's native life in it.

Ora allowed this. It had been a long flight, the Orsinx were running low on fuel, and not needing to fight a war to continue on their way was advantageous.

For at least six millennia, Vanai and her Falinari travelled with the Orsinx fleet. They possesed five of colony ships and a thousand fighters, managing to save about a million people and over 300 species, most of which were preserved in stasis. As Ora was the ultimate commander of the fleet, Vanai spent a lot of time bargaining with him over their courses of action; her ability to calmly talk him down from his famous rages was well-known and appreciated by Falinari and Orsinx alike.

And then the fleet found Senti, and began a war with the inhabitants. Vanai tried to keep the Falanari out of it as much as possible, but some conflict was unavoidable. One Falanar managed to communicate with one of Aisenn's saenshi, which became a key to their escape-- as the twin demigods began to wreck havoc upon Ora's forces, the saenshi smuggled away on the Falanari ships, then infiltrated the Orsinx ships while wearing their faces. As Ora fled the planet's surface, the saenshi destroyed hundreds of Orsinx ships, sending what was left of the fleet fleeing for their lives.

And then Vanai and the Falanari were free to join the Sentan people and rebuild.

Current Day

Vanai spends most of her time within Celessani with Aisenn. The temple is comfortable, and she can reach her charges on the moon quite easily. She has no real intention of getting heavily involved in mortal affairs again for quite some time, but from time to time she does follow one of her Falinari into Terra to investigate the strange, futuristic world beyond the tear in reality.

Skills

Time Magic
Vanai's powers are tied to the concept of time. Her domain is the passage of time and the changes it brings, whether positive or negative. Like all gods, her magic radiates around her, and in large doses it has negative effects; those who stay too close for too long may end up ageing prematurely or crumbling to dust. These negative effects don't occur within the metaphysical realms in which she usually dwells.
Imbued Blood
Like the blood of all gods, Vanai's is a metallic golden liquid that is heavily imbued with her specific flavour of magic. Much like her aura, her blood causes time to progress faster for anything it touches. It can be used to create powerful healing spells and deadly curses.
Metaphysical Travel and Manipulation
Like most of her people, Vanai can travel through planes of reality above that of the physical; she can also generate and manipulate anything she desires within these higher spaces. Unlike many others, Vanai doesn't have her own "retreat"; she tends to stay with Aisenn instead.
Perception Manipulation
Vanai is capable of appearing to mortals in any chosen form. In most cases, her colouration and build remain the same, but there are exceptions, especially when becoming something like a human. As this power is perception-based, it doesn't function when recorded in photographs or video footage-- but what the camera sees is not what mortals see.
